Abstract

Perkembangan teknologi finansial (fintech) di Indonesia telah merambah ke berbagai sektor usaha, termasuk sektor usaha mikro, kecil, dan menengah (UMKM). Salah satu contoh konkret penerapannya adalah pada toko sembako, yang kini mulai mengadopsi layanan fintech seperti pembayaran digital, aplikasi kasir, dan sistem pencatatan keuangan otomatis.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k mengetahui pengaruh penggunaan fintech terhadap peningkatan pendapatan penjualan di Toko Sembako Juli Shop SRC. Metode yang digunakan adalah kuantitatif dengan pendekatan deskriptif. Data dikumpulkan melalui observasi langsung, wawancara, serta penyebaran kuesioner. Hasil analisis menunjukkan bahwa penggunaan fintech memberikan dampak positif yang signifikan terhadap peningkatan efisiensi, loyalitas pelanggan, serta pendapatan toko. Penelitian ini diharapkan dapat menjadi referensi bagi pelaku UMKM lain untuk menerapkan teknologi finansial dalam kegiatan bisnis sehari-hari.
